Is it "mentally unbalanced" or "mentally imbalanced"? What is the difference?
Question:
Answers:
Unbalanced – disturbed, deranged, unstable
Imbalanced – unfair, excessive, extreme
You can be mentally unbalanced and chemicaly imbalanced.
